    Hi twillynit, ProcessGuardis not a scanner and it is best that your machine is as clean as possible before intalling.
    Once installed ProcessGuard has a learning mode which allows you to run your trusted programs and creates the rules necessary for then to run properly, so if malware were to start during this process then there is a chance that your PC could be compromised as the malware executables would be added to both the Security list and protection list.

    So my advice is to ensure that you have the latest MS patches, update your AV /AT and Anti-Spyware programs and do full scans before installing PG.

    Installing PG on a newly installed OS is the best possible scenario.

    Once installed and out of learning mode you will have added one of the most effective levels of protection available, without a doubt it is worth the time and effort involved.
